Steps to reproduce:
Here's the sample link.
http://i.imgur.com/6dGFjgJ.gifv
If i opened that gif, then right click->save video as; Sometimes it give me the webm, but more often it give me gifv.
If i download the gifv, they unusable, because the gifv filesize is only 5 kb or so.
Actual results:
Inconsistency "save video as" behaviour, sometimes it give the correct webm, but more often it give me gifv.
The gifv is unusable, since it's not the real file.
Expected results:
It should give me webm.

I do get gifv every single time no matter what I do. Firefox 46 Dev, Win8 64-bit.
Example link: https://i.imgur.com/lDwSHXi.webm
This link will redirect to .gifv, .gifv is actually a HTML page with <video> & 2 <source> tags (webm, mp4)
When you right click "Save Video As", you get .gifv (html) file instead.
